Abstract
Shareholders aren't passive observers anymoreβand increasingly they have been rallying to defeat corporate mergers and acquisitions (M&As) that they don't like. So what strategies can management use to plan and govern in the face of today's growing shareholder activism? Β© 2012 Wiley Periodicals, Inc.
